摘要
本文描述了一个倾斜交叉、差分式激光热透镜光谱法。采用本方法可消除较高的溶剂空白的影响。文章讨论了调制频率和泵浦光功率对热透镜信号的影响,给出了检测Cu^(2+)的工作曲线,讨论了影响方法灵敏度的诸因素,提出了可能的改进方案。
This paper described an obliquely crossed and differential thermal lens(TL) spectrometry, the device can eliminate high solvent effect. The effects of chopping frequency and pump beam power on the TL signal were discussed. The working curve of copper ion was given. Some factors affecting sensitivity were discussed, and possible improvement schemes were given.
